Despite the pre-designed modules, modular homes offer a remarkable degree of design flexibility. Buyers can choose from a wide range of floor plans and module combinations to create a home that suits their unique needs and preferences. They can also personalize their homes with various interior finishes, fixtures, and appliances. Modular homes provide the freedom to design a home that reflects their individual style and taste.

Smart pool systems allow you to control and monitor your pool equipment from anywhere using your smartphone or tablet. Adjust water temperature, activate pumps, or set schedules for filtration and lighting—all at the touch of a button. Automating these functions means less hands-on maintenance and more time enjoying your pool. Since most of the construction is done off-site, modular construction significantly reduces the environmental impact on the construction site. This approach leads to less soil erosion, less damage to the local ecosystem, and a reduction in the site’s carbon footprint. Modular buildings are often more energy-efficient than traditional buildings. The controlled environment of a factory allows for better insulation and airtightness, leading to reduced energy consumption in heating and cooling. Furthermore, research suggests that modular buildings can be up to 15% more energy-efficient than conventional buildings.
